Al usar matlab
, a menudo podemos encontrarnos, a'
y a.'
, pero cada vez que estamos más confundidos, ¿cuál es la diferencia entre los dos? Haz un registro aquí.
Debido a que csdn
no hay un matlab
bloque de código, el bloque de código utilizado está python
escrito, matlab
los comentarios en el real deben usarse%
a = [1+0i 2+1i 3+0i 4+1i];
a'
a.'
"""
ans =
1.0000 + 0.0000i
2.0000 - 1.0000i
3.0000 + 0.0000i
4.0000 - 1.0000i
ans =
1.0000 + 0.0000i
2.0000 + 1.0000i
3.0000 + 0.0000i
4.0000 + 1.0000i
"""
Podemos ver que el a'
resultado de salida es a
la transpuesta conjugada compleja de la matriz original . a.'
El resultado de salida es a
la matriz transpuesta de la matriz original . En la versión anterior del matlab
equivalente transpose(a)
, en una nueva versión del matlab
equivalente a.T
.
La palabra clave no es fácil, si la encuentra útil, levante la mano para dar un me gusta y déjeme recomendarla para que la vea más gente ~